Quinn might reopen 7 closed state parks

SPRINGFIELD -- Illinois Gov. Pat Quinn is hinting that he'll soon reopen seven closed state parks.

Quinn told reporters Wednesday that he'll have an announcement Thursday at the state Department of Natural Resources. And he says state park fans will "like what we have to say."

Quinn's predecessor, Rod Blagojevich, closed seven state parks and a dozen historic sites last fall in a budget-cutting move.

When Quinn took the place of the ejected Blagojevich, he promised to reopen the parks.

Despite a budget deficit of $9 billion or more, Quinn says people need state parks open for recreation because tight finances will limit vacations.
